简介:

通过点击页面侧边菜单,对应的页面加载时伴随着滑动过渡动画,还带进度条效果的。
当然页面的加载是Ajax驱动的,整个加载过渡过程非常流畅,非常好的用户体验。

HTML:
HTML结构中,.cd-main包含页面主体内容,.cd-side-navigation包含着侧边导航条,#cd-loading-bar则是用来做进度条动画用的。
CSS:
我们将.cd-side-navigation固定在页面左侧,并且设置它的高度为100%,这样左侧导航菜单就始终占据左侧边栏,右侧主体内容滚动时,左侧导航菜单不动。
JavaScript:
当我们点击左侧菜单时,调用triggerAnimation()函数,这个函数会触发加载进度条动画函数loadingBarAnimation(),接着加载页面内容函数:loadNewContent()。
当新页面被选中时,一个新的元素.cd-section将会被创建并且插入到DOM中,然后load()新的url内容。
通过异步加载的页面要返回上一页历史浏览记录的话,可以点击浏览器上的返回即可。返回上一页同样有过渡动画效果。

网盘下载地址:

http://kekewl.cc/pXu5AQEyx150

图片:

漂亮的页面过渡动画源码相关推荐

  1. 好看的动漫html页面,漂亮的页面过渡动画

    HTML HTML结构中,.cd-main包含页面主体内容,.cd-side-navigation包含着侧边导航条,#cd-loading-bar则是用来做进度条动画用的. Intro Animate ...

  2. 8个超震撼的HTML5和纯CSS3动画源码

    HTML5和CSS3之所以强大,不仅因为现在大量的浏览器的支持,更是因为它们已经越来越能满足现代开发的需要.Flash在几年之后肯定会消亡,那么HTML5和CSS3将会替代Flash.今天我们要给大家 ...

  3. 纯html css动画效果,8个超震撼的HTML5和纯CSS3动画源码

    本文作者html5tricks,转载请注明出处 1.HTML5 Canvas水波纹动画特效 HTML5的Canvas特性非常实用,我们不仅可以在Canvas画布上绘制各种图形,也可以制作绚丽的动画,比 ...

  4. 一个简单漂亮的网址导航HTML5源码

    正文: 一个简单漂亮的网址导航HTML5源码页面自适应,手机电脑都自动适应大小. 纯HTML代码,然后一个CSS一个JS文件,根据设备自适应,更多信息自行研究,修改index.html内容. 字节网盘 ...

  5. html404页面怎么添加,404怎么办-页面自适应html源码

    404页面是客户端在浏览网页时,当 当遇到404的时候,一般会提醒用户,页面丢失,并且有些网站还会推荐相关内容,从而留住用户.或者直接提供搜索框,供客户搜索网站内容. 网站的404页面非常的丑,给用户 ...

  6. PHP随机静态页面生成系统源码雨尘SEO系统

    介绍: PHP随机静态页面生成系统源码雨尘SEO系统v1.3 一款随机静态页面生成系统,一秒钟可生成上千条单页面,批量生成单页用来做SEO是非常不错的源码. 雨尘SEO静态页面生成系统源码v1.3版本 ...

  7. PHP随机静态页面生成系统源码雨尘SEO系统v1.3

    介绍: PHP随机静态页面生成系统源码雨尘SEO系统v1.3 一款随机静态页面生成系统,一秒钟可生成上千条单页面,批量生成单页用来做SEO是非常不错的源码.雨尘SEO静态页面生成系统源码v1.3版本, ...

  8. 网站维护404页面带音乐源码CSS本地化

    介绍: 可以用来当网站维护界面 404页面 502页面 都可以 源码简单CSS本地化 不是网上泛滥的版本 已经修复 网盘下载地址: http://kekewl.org/evdg1g1TT310 图片:

  9. html动画爱心制作代码,CSS心形加载的动画源码的实现

    废话不多说上代码,代码很简答,研究一下就明白了,有不明白的可以问我. .heart-loading { margin-top: 120px; width: 200px; height: 200px; ...

最新文章

  1. backtrack X server 启动不了
  2. 装上螺旋桨,加州理工让只能行走的双足机器人「上了天」,还玩起了障碍滑板、走绳索...
  3. 学习率对神经网络的影响-乙烷,乙烯,乙炔的分子模型试验数据对比
  4. 手动创建DataTable
  5. Jarvis OJ web(一)
  6. C语言中字符型和浮点型能否相加,C语言中数据结构的基本类型(整型、浮点型和字符型)...
  7. it有啥好咨询的_小经验 | 埃森哲Accenture管理咨询+IT咨询实习
  8. ajax获取的json作用域,ajax;jsonp;箭头函数;let关键字;const关键字
  9. 转眼人到中年:前端老程序员无法忘怀的一次百度电话面试(二)
  10. Linux 系统文件及结构
  11. 第九章:SpringCloud Feign几个坑
  12. 你是否真的适合搞NDK开发?
  13. 自定义吐司Toast小进阶
  14. java 中半圆的函数,前端程序员必须掌握之三角函数在前端动画中的应用
  15. redis缓存Hash操作的在主数据中的应用
  16. EasyExcel 冻结固定表头 和搜索
  17. 服务器传奇网站搭建修改教程,传奇架设教程如何修改爆率
  18. 电石炉技术的发展及电石炉尾气解决方案
  19. 微服务架构之限流熔断
  20. git 安装后,右键没有 git clone

热门文章

  1. linux命令---tar
  2. 408业务课·计算机网络——【考研随笔】之一
  3. c#的winform调用外部exe作为子窗体
  4. Flex 4 NativeWindow 中添加Flex组件(问题很多,尚不完善)
  5. sdh管理单元指针_SDH设备上STM-1接口是啥玩意
  6. 信息学奥赛一本通 1110:查找特定的值 | OpenJudge NOI 1.9 01
  7. 信息学奥赛一本通 1041:奇偶数判断 | OpenJudge NOI 1.4 03
  8. Oulipo(POJ-3461)
  9. 台阶问题(洛谷-P1192)
  10. 输出亲朋字符串(信息学奥赛一本通-T1133)